Ticket: Staging env misconfigured for Siftgate bloom filter

The bloom layer in front of the Pellet KV store is rejecting all lookups in staging because the env file was copied from the dev template without credentials. False-positive tuning values are fine; only the auth line is missing. To unblock the weekly demo, the Pellet admission secret must be set on the following line.

env line for yaguf-fajop: LEDGER_TOKEN13=fb08984397349

Subject: Graphlume 2.4 cut

Release channel,

Graphlume 2.4 is tagged. Changes: cycle detection rewritten, edge bundling off by default, lazy loading for graphs over 10k nodes. Known issue: export to SVG drops cluster labels on nested groups; fix lands in 2.4.1. Future maintainers: the renderer config moved to graphlume.toml, old flags are ignored silently — check there first before filing anything. Artifacts are on the internal mirror. Verify your download against the build token below.

trace token, faduf-hahig: htk4_b8f9

Runbook — Crumbline order cutoff (read this before your first on-call shift)

Crumbline locks next-day bakery orders at a nightly cutoff so the Millbrook kitchen gets a final count. If the cutoff job hangs, orders keep trickling in and the kitchen over- or under-bakes — not fun. Check the scheduler first, then the lock table. You can push the cutoff back once per night, max 30 minutes. The cutoff job reads its settings at startup, and the current values are these.

settings of taguf-fajef:
[eliath]
team = julir
access_code = ac_78465c
host = eliath.lumicgrid.local
port = 8443
owner = feniel.wenir
peer = quenmir.tolvaqsys.local